Description: Pair of Meissen polychrome porcelain sculptures depicting scenes of women from the late 19th century.
Both sculptures represent mythological figures typical of the eclectic taste of the late 19th century.
The largest figure is represented with a long purple-pink dress that covers a robe finely decorated with floral motifs and is leaning on a thrip with a flame above it.
The smallest figure represents a nymph rising from the waters caught in the act of lifting a veil over her head.
